Head injuries may worsen cognitive decline decades later

Individuals who skilled head accidents of their 50s or youthful rating decrease than anticipated on cognitive checks at age 70, based on a examine led by UCL researchers.

Head accidents didn’t seem to contribute to mind injury attribute of Alzheimer’s illness, however would possibly make individuals extra weak to dementia signs, based on the findings printed in Annals of Medical and Translational Neurology.

Lead creator Dr Sarah-Naomi James (MRC Unit for Lifelong Well being and Ageing at UCL) stated: “Right here we discovered compelling proof that head accidents in early or mid-life can have a small however vital influence on mind well being and pondering abilities in the long run. It is likely to be {that a} head damage makes the mind extra weak to, or accelerates, the traditional mind ageing course of.”

The examine concerned 502 contributors of the UK’s longest-running cohort examine, the MRC Nationwide Survey of Well being and Improvement Cohort, which has been following contributors since their beginning in the identical week in 1946.

At age 53, they had been requested ‘Have you ever ever been knocked unconscious?’ to evaluate whether or not they had ever suffered a considerable head damage; 21% of their pattern had answered sure to this query. After which round age 70 (69-71), the examine contributors underwent mind scans (PET/MRI), they usually took a collection of cognitive checks.

The contributors had all accomplished standardised cognitive checks at age eight, so the researchers had been in a position to examine their outcomes at age 70 with anticipated outcomes primarily based on their childhood cognition and different elements comparable to academic attainment and socioeconomic standing.

The researchers discovered that 70-year-olds who had skilled a critical head damage greater than 15 years earlier carried out barely worse than anticipated on cognitive checks for consideration and fast pondering (a distinction of two factors, scoring 46 versus 48 on a 93-point scale). In addition they had smaller mind volumes (by 1%) and variations in mind microstructural integrity, in keeping with proof from earlier research, which can clarify the refined cognitive variations.

The researchers didn’t discover any variations in ranges of the amyloid protein, implicated in Alzheimer’s illness, or different indicators of Alzheimer’s-related injury.

Dr James stated: “It seems like head accidents could make our brains extra weak to the traditional results of ageing. We’ve got not discovered proof {that a} head damage would trigger dementia, however it may exacerbate or speed up some dementia signs.”

Joint senior creator Professor Jonathan Schott (UCL Dementia Analysis Centre, UCL Queen Sq. Institute of Neurology) stated: “This provides to a rising physique of proof linking head damage with mind well being a few years later, with but extra causes to guard the mind from damage wherever doable.”

The researchers didn’t have knowledge on the frequency, severity or reason for the top accidents, to see if long-term impacts may need been even higher for sure individuals. The teachers are persevering with their analysis with this cohort to see if neurodegeneration or cognitive decline continues in late life amongst these with previous head accidents.

Joint senior creator Professor Nick Fox (UCL Dementia Analysis Centre and UK Dementia Analysis Institute at UCL) added: “Critical head damage can have fast devastating results, however what’s changing into more and more clear is that much less extreme however repeated head accidents – comparable to these sustained in touch sports activities – can impact mind well being a few years later.

“Our examine exhibits that, even within the basic inhabitants, a head damage enough to trigger a lack of consciousness can subtly have an effect on cognition in later life. It has by no means been extra clear that we have to do all we are able to to guard our brains from damage all through our lives.”

The examine was funded by Alzheimer’s Analysis UK, the Medical Analysis Council (MRC) Dementias Platform UK, the Wolfson Basis and The Drake Basis, and concerned researchers at UCL, London Faculty of Hygiene and Tropical Medication, King’s School London, College of Gothenburg and the UK Dementia Analysis Institute.
